Designing Waveforms with Adjustable PAPR for Integrated Sensing and Communication

Published in IEEE Conference Proceedings, 2025

This work introduces a waveform-design framework for ISAC systems in which the peak-to-average power ratio (PAPR) is treated as a tunable parameter. The design preserves sensing and communication performance across a range of PAPR targets, easing the impact of high-PAPR modern waveforms on practical RF hardware.
